Best practices for responsive website navigation design

Best practices for responsive website navigation design

Best Practices for Responsive Website Navigation Design


Responsive web design is essential in today’s mobile-driven world. As users access websites on a variety of devices with different screen sizes, responsive navigation design becomes crucial for providing a seamless and user-friendly experience. In this article, we will explore the best practices for responsive website navigation design, ensuring that navigation adapts effectively to different devices while maintaining usability and enhancing user experience.

Clear and Concise Labels:

Labeling for Clarity

Clear and concise labels are fundamental for responsive navigation design. When screen space is limited, it becomes even more important to use succinct and descriptive labels for navigation elements. Avoid using jargon or complex terminology and opt for intuitive and easily understandable labels. Users should be able to comprehend the purpose of each navigation item at a glance, regardless of the device they are using. Well-crafted labels improve navigation comprehension and enable users to find desired content or features quickly.

Prioritizing Key Navigation Items

Responsive navigation requires prioritizing key navigation items for different screen sizes. In smaller screens, such as mobile devices, it may not be feasible to display the entire navigation menu. In such cases, consider implementing a collapsed menu, commonly known as a hamburger menu, that expands when clicked. Carefully select the most important and frequently accessed navigation items to be visible in the collapsed menu, while less crucial items can be placed in secondary menus or submenus. Prioritizing key navigation items ensures that users can access essential content even in limited screen space.

Streamlined and Simplified Structure:

Streamlining Navigation Structure

Responsive navigation design calls for a streamlined and simplified navigation structure. Consider consolidating and condensing navigation elements to avoid overwhelming users with excessive options. Instead of cluttering the navigation with numerous categories or subcategories, strive for a simplified structure that focuses on the most critical sections of the website. Streamlining the navigation structure enhances usability and allows users to navigate seamlessly, even on smaller screens.

Implementing Dropdown Menus

Dropdown menus are an effective solution for presenting a hierarchical navigation structure in limited screen space. When the screen size shrinks, a compact dropdown menu can provide access to subcategories or additional navigation options. However, it’s crucial to ensure that dropdown menus are easy to use and navigate, particularly on touch devices. Implementing large, touch-friendly dropdown menus and providing clear indicators of dropdown functionality, such as arrows or icons, improves the user experience and simplifies navigation on responsive websites.

Thumb-Friendly Design:

Easy Touch Target Sizes

Responsive navigation design should consider the convenience of touch interactions, especially on mobile devices. Since users primarily use their thumbs to interact with touchscreens, it’s essential to create touch target sizes that are large enough to accommodate finger taps accurately. Larger touch targets reduce the chances of accidental taps and improve the overall usability of the navigation. Ensure that navigation elements, such as menu items or buttons, have sufficient spacing between them to avoid any unintended touch inputs.

Sticky Navigation

Sticky navigation refers to a design technique where the navigation bar remains fixed at the top or bottom of the screen as users scroll. This technique is particularly useful for responsive design as it ensures constant access to the navigation, regardless of the scroll position. Sticky navigation enhances user convenience, allowing them to access different sections of the website without having to scroll back to the top. It provides a sense of continuity and eliminates the need for repetitive scrolling, improving the overall user experience.

Visual Cues and Feedback:

Highlighting Active Navigation Items

In responsive navigation design, it’s essential to provide visual cues that indicate the active navigation item. When users are browsing multiple sections or pages, it’s crucial for them to know their current location within the website. Highlighting the active navigation item, such as changing its color, adding an underline, or using a different font weight, helps users orient themselves and understand where they are within the website’s hierarchy. Visual cues provide feedback and improve navigation comprehension on responsive websites.

Visual Differentiation for Interaction States

Interaction states, such as hover and click, should be visually differentiated in responsive navigation design. When users interact with navigation elements, they expect to see a clear indication of their actions. For example, on touch devices, where hover effects are not applicable, providing visual feedback on tap or press can help users understand that their interaction has been registered. Differentiating interaction states through color changes, animations, or subtle visual cues enhances the responsiveness of navigation and improves the overall user experience.


Responsive website navigation design plays a pivotal role in delivering a user-friendly and seamless experience across devices. By implementing best practices such as clear and concise labels, prioritizing key navigation items, streamlining the structure, considering thumb-friendly design, incorporating visual cues, and providing feedback, website owners can ensure that navigation adapts effectively to different screen sizes while maintaining usability and enhancing user experience. By prioritizing responsive navigation design, businesses can engage users effectively, drive conversions, and create a positive brand image in the digital landscape.

About Us

We are a professional web design, SEO, and digital marketing company specializing in web development, branding, and digital marketing.

Contact Us

We would love the opportunity to work on your new project. Contact us for a free consultation.